YES!!! This is one of the main reasons LIVE is more of an enhanced drum loop manipulator rather than a full composition environment for me- I hit stop on a textural, long release sound, and it waits the specified quantize amount, then stops abruptly...
An adjustable crossfade time at the clip level would solve this-As would a release envelope per clip, that would fade the clip out over a specified time when the stop button was press or another clip was activated.
